Clotting in the air.

In recent years there has been much debate about an association between long-distance air travel and thrombosis.12 In today's Lancet, Anja Schreijer and colleagues3 report a study done in the framework of the WHO Research Into Global Hazards of Travel Initiative (WRIGHT) which adds an important piece of evidence to the mosaic of travel-induced thrombosis. The Dutch group compared the concentrations of markers of coagulation activation in blood samples of healthy volunteers drawn before, during, and immediately after an 8-h flight, with those taken at the same time points during 8 h of immobilisation in a cinema, and during normal daily activities. In doing so, the conditions of immobilisation and hypobaric hypoxia (flight) could be disentangled from immobilisation alone (cinema) and be controlled for circadian rhythm (daily activities). By including almost 40% of participants with the factor V Leiden mutation or women on oral contraceptives, itwas possible to assess the effect of these risk factors on coagulation activation. The authors found increased concentrations in markers during flight compared with the other two situations, especially in volunteers with genetic (factor V Leiden) or extrinsic (oral contraceptives) risk factors. They conclude that activation of coagulation and fibrinolysis occur in some susceptible individuals after an 8-h flight due to a mechanism inherent in air travel, in addition to immobilisation.
